Answer to Question 1

The bacteria from the soil live in the nodules on the roots of plants. Plants need nitrogen and bacteria need nutrients from the plant to live. The bacteria take these nutrients from the plant and convert nitrogen from the air in the soil into a form of nitrogen that the plant can use.
